Sugar Bowl Challenge ~ 61

I'm back with my card for the new Sugar Bowl challenge..gosh I think the weeks go by quickly, but it's been a year since my first Sugar Bowl card and I can't believe how quickly that went! They do say time flies when you're having fun, so I must be having a blast! (Or getting old?)
The sketch for this challenge has been done by Sweetie Kiki and the optional theme is Weddings/Love.
Since I am rather lacking in wedding images then I went with love instead.


Maybe I should've warned you first? Another card with no Sassy image on it! I thought I would practice what I preach and dig out a much older stamp for this challenge. This is Luvvie, a Leanne Ellis Annie image, I love this little cutie and it's one of my very well used stamps.
As usual, she's been coloured with DI's and Nick Bantock inks, the papers are MME Stella & Rose (Hattie) which I've been stroking since March so I thought it was about time I actually used them.
The sentiment is from Waltzing Mouse Stamps, the flowers are a MFT die which I've had for absolutely yonks but never used yet I keep admiring them on Fi's blog, a few pearls and the jobs done.


The fabulous prize for one lucky winner is a set of 6 pick'n'mix Sugar Nellie stamps. As always, you can find all the details over on the Sugar Bowl blog along with lots of lovely inspiration from all the other sweeties.
